Transaction 81e2786d2b2d8288c2b7f48c978dcb691c93a68268a59a7a20e6812ce41869c3

1 Input
1 Outputs
  • 81e2786d2b2d8288c2b7f48c978dcb691c93a68268a59a7a20e6812ce41869c3:0
  • value  4999876317
    address  3QkdTRMiigEZpiJ7KjYiAN4MjvSNvi5vDY